Hope I don't bore you guys with these shots. Scanned them off old photos. I bought a new 200M in 1985 and rode that thing hard for 19 years. Paid $1385 new and sold it in '04 for $750. It's still alive as a buddy at work bought it 3 years ago and saw my name in the manual.

The rarest, most sought after, and fastest three wheeler ever made, the Tiger 500. Sporting a 482cc, 2-stroke Rotex power plant producing top speeds of over 100 MPH bone stock.
